1. Most Small Businesses Aren’t Sellable—Here’s Why

Pete drops a truth bomb early in the conversation: 95% of small businesses are considered unsellable. Why?

  • They don’t hit a critical $500K annual net margin.

  • They’re completely owner-dependent.

If your business can’t function without you, what you have isn’t a business—it’s a job. A demanding one, at that.

This is your wake-up call. Want to build an asset, not just a hustle? You need to scale through people and systems.

3. Hiring is the First Step to Getting Your Life Back

Many agents resist hiring because they don’t believe anyone will work as hard as they do. But here’s the reality: the right hire will eventually outperform you at that role—because it’s their only focus.

Pete breaks hiring down into a clear, repeatable framework:

  • Define your core values.

  • Write a clear, detailed job description (not just a posting).

  • Use a DISC profile to match personality to role.

  • Establish KPIs (Key Performance Indicators) to measure performance.

  • Let go to grow.

If you’ve ever felt trapped by your business, this is your exit plan.
